Very young puppies don’t have much endurance. They shouldn’t be walked too far. A rule of thumb is a puppy can walk five minutes for every month of age starting at eight weeks. So a two-month-old puppy can walk about 10 minutes. And a three-month-old can walk for 15 minutes; and a four-month-old for 20 minutes. And so forth.Walking can go a long way toward bringing blood pressure levels down to normal, according to the American Heart Association (AHA). In fact, walking is as effective as running for lowering blood pressure. To get this benefit, the AHA advises walking for an average of 40 minutes at a moderate to vigorous pace just three or four days a week.To. Most patients are able to walk independently after a hip replacement, but the amount of walking may vary. For the first few weeks, it is common to only be able to walk short distances. However, by 5 weeks post-surgery, most patients are able to walk for longer periods of time. If you are walking at a brisk speed of 4.0 miles per hour, it would take 15 minutes to walk one mile. Five kilometers equals 3.1 miles. At a typical walking pace, you can walk a 5K in 45 minutes. If you are a slower or beginner walker, you might take 60 minutes or more. When choosing a 5K event, make sure it welcomes walkers and has a long enough time limit so you can comfortably finish. The Watkin Path (8 miles/13km) takes you from Nant Gwynant to the summit. Starting from Pont Bethania car park, you can see some of the old copper mine workings along the way. From Llyn Cwellyn car park, the Snowdon Ranger Path (8 miles/13km) winds up the side of Snowdon, giving you views of the many lakes in the area.31 Jan 2013 ... By Mendy Hecht. Because driving, biking, blading, skateboarding or other device-driven means of transportation are prohibited on Shabbat, we walk rather than commute to synagogue. However, even walking on Shabbat has its limits. Jewish law sets the maximum walking range from one’s city to 2,000 cubits (3,049.5 feet, 0.596 miles (960 meters).
